TRACOPOWER TMR Series DC-DC Converter, 12V DC Output Voltage, 4W Power Rating - TMR 4-4812WI


This DC-DC converter provides a solution for power management in various applications. With a power rating of 4W and an input voltage range of 18 to 75V DC, it is suitable for multiple electronic devices. The converter serves as a compact power supply, making it essential for users in the automation and electronics industries.

Features & Benefits


• High-efficiency operation of up to 83% reduces energy consumption
• Compact SIP-8 package design optimises board space
• I/O isolation of 1600V DC enhances safety
• Remote On/Off control allows for easy management of power applications

Applications


• Suitable for automation equipment requiring a stable power supply
• Ideal for electronics systems needing a 12V DC output
• Utilised in medical devices due to relevant approvals
• Appropriate for PCB-mounted requiring compact solutions
• Implemented in telecommunication systems for efficient voltage regulation

What is the typical output current of this device?


The output current is 333mA at a nominal voltage of 12V DC.

How does one install this converter on a PCB?


This device is designed for PCB mounting, utilising through-hole connections for secure installation.

What measures are in place for protection against power surges?


The converter includes built-in short-circuit and overload protection to defend against potential damage.

Can it function within various temperature environments?


Yes, it is designed to operate in a temperature range of -40 to +85°C without derating.
